RT Oncology and Express Scripts enter into pharmaceutical drug distribution agreement

NewsGuard 100/100 Score

RT Oncology Services Corporation ("RainTree"), the nation's leading community oncology alliance, and Express Scripts (NASDAQ: ESRX), the nation's leading pharmacy benefit manager, today announced that they have entered into an exclusive, three-year pharmaceutical drug distribution agreement.

Per the agreement, CuraScript Specialty Distribution, an Express Scripts business, will provide pharmaceuticals, oncology supportive therapies, vaccines, biologicals and other products (excluding intravenous and infusible oncology medications) to RainTree members. The RainTree community oncology practice membership currently includes a total of approximately 700 physicians in over 50 practices nationwide and is continuing to expand as new members join. RainTree will not be distributing or marketing intravenous or infusible oncology medications through July 1, 2014.

Mike Martin, president and chief executive officer of RainTree, said, "Our agreement with Express Scripts will enable community oncology practices, which treat the majority of cancer patients in the United States, to provide access to medications at the point of care. By giving these practices the tools they need to provide better, more integrated care, this agreement represents a major step forward in our mission to revolutionize both practice performance and patient care, while reducing the cost to the healthcare system."

Gayle Johnston, president of CuraScript Specialty Distribution, said, "This agreement allows us the opportunity to better serve the needs of community-based oncologists with the depth and breadth of our solutions. By combining our expertise and scale with the unique business approach of RainTree, we believe we can do even more to help better manage the cost of treatment for physicians and patients."

This agreement is part of an ongoing series of strategic collaborations that RainTree is undertaking with other companies to further integrate and personalize care for the patients of community oncology practices. RainTree and Express Scripts have previously announced the creation of a novel, expanded oral oncology dispensing network with the goal of improving patient care by increasing point-of-care access to oral cancer medications and enhancing follow-up patient compliance and adherence.
